A .NET GUI framework for TCC batch scripts.
FormCast is a .NET plugin for Take Command Console (TCC) v36+ that turns BTM batch scripts into full Windows applications. Build native GUI forms, handle events, manage layouts, and ship script-driven tools that run like real desktop apps -- all from TCC.
Think of FormCast as a UI layer for TCC scripts.
TCC scripts are powerful, but historically limited to console interaction. FormCast extends TCC with a structured UI layer so you can:
- add a structured UI layer on top of existing TCC workflows
- build interactive tools with validated input instead of manual prompts
- create script-driven utilities that behave like real desktop applications
- provide users with clear, guided interfaces instead of command syntax
- visualize progress, status, and results in real time
- package and run scripts in standalone app mode with no visible console
A minimal form that captures input and exits:
call formcast-check.btm load
set h=%@formopen[form,hello,0,0,280,160]
set RC=%@formadd[%h,lbl1,label,20,18,100,20,Name:]
set RC=%@formadd[%h,name,edit,110,16,140,22,]
set RC=%@formadd[%h,ok,button,100,60,80,28,OK]
set RC=%@formset[%h,.,acceptbutton,ok]
set RC=%@formshow[%h,modal]
set name=%@formget[%h,name,text]
set RC=%@formclose[%h]
plugin /u FormCast
echo Hello, %name

Run a BTM as a full desktop application with no visible console:
myapp.btm /app
The TCC console is hidden. The user sees only the FormCast window, with
a custom taskbar icon and title. See Install below for the desktop
shortcut recipe that launches /app mode with zero flash.

To build:
- .NET Framework 4.8 runtime
- .NET SDK (or Visual Studio 2022+) with the .NET Framework 4.8 targeting pack
To run:
- Take Command / TCC v36 or later
- Windows 10 or later, x64. ARM64 works via x64 emulation.
From the repo root:
dotnet build FormCast.sln -c ReleaseOutput:
src\FormCast\bin\Release\net48\FormCast.dll-- the pluginsrc\FormCast.Host\bin\Release\net48\FormCast.Host.exe-- the cross-process daemon (optional, used only byGlobal\forms)
- Download the latest FormCast release zip from the releases page and extract it.
- Copy the entire
bin/directory to a permanent location (e.g.C:\FormCast\bin\). All dependency DLLs must stay alongsideFormCast.dll. - Set the
FORMCAST_DLLenvironment variable:
set FORMCAST_DLL=C:\FormCast\bin\FormCast.dll
- Load the plugin:
plugin /l %FORMCAST_DLL
@FORMVERSION returns the loaded version. To unload:
plugin /u FormCast
Desktop shortcut (zero-flash launch for /app mode):
| Field | Value |
|---|---|
| Target | "C:\path\to\tcc.exe" /c start /inv /pgm "C:\path\to\tcc.exe" /c "C:\path\to\myapp.btm" /app |
| Start in | Directory containing the BTM |
| Run | Minimized |
The FORMCAST_DLL variable is used by the /app standalone
mode and the shared formcast-check.btm helper so BTM scripts can
find the plugin without hardcoded paths.
